Synthesis of La2Mo2O9 nanocrystallites by Sol-gel process
La2Mo2O9 nanocrystallites were synthesized successfully using Sol-gel process with (NH4)6Mo7O24·4H2O,La(NO3)3·6H2O,citric acid and PEG400 as original materials.The result shows that spherical well-crystallized La2Mo2O9 nanoparticles were formed at 500℃ with sizes of ca.80 and 20nm,which indicates the secondary nucleation exists in the reaction process.The synthesized La2Mo2O9 nanocrystallites were characterized by XRD,TEM,IR and UV-Vis spectrum,respectively.
